Output d737f059f3d3b58de39e1c9531b347c267ec2a91a41ee1cfe5c6b266c83440d4:15

value
1080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db9d82e8fc99d4739a2f0384ca53fb4b2f7f469 OP_EQUAL
address
3AEbQ5o3wPAj24N76yvrcXmrJUrqLdzA5h
transaction
d737f059f3d3b58de39e1c9531b347c267ec2a91a41ee1cfe5c6b266c83440d4
confirmations
131704
spent
true